Transaction 70f1a516fdd151bba511f2a156b309485d135d25a2d5ff829b744f2ae3c8654d

100 Input
1 Outputs
  • 70f1a516fdd151bba511f2a156b309485d135d25a2d5ff829b744f2ae3c8654d:0
  • value  30523602
    address  16r7U7GqbVPeKukgfd3mUN9LCkuoKbfpXM